Historical Event on 4/24/1974
Ramdhari Singh alias 'Dinkar', veteran famous Hindi writer and poet, passed away.

8/6/1920 | Film Censor Board at Bombay started working. The first film censored and granted a Censor Certificate No. 1 was a short film of 600 ft., produced by Gaumont Company and it was titled as 'Gaumont Graphic No. 963-964'. The Regional Film Censor Boards were also set-up in Calcutta, Madras and Rangoon. |
